DescriptionPublished 1962 by Archie ComicsMonster Gorilla! The Fly was created by Joe Simon and first published in 1959. The series ran for 39 issues through three imprints before being cancelled in 1967. The series was revived in the 80's under the Red Circle imprint. DC later licensed the character for its Impact comics line. The character has reclaimed by Joe Simon in 1999. Tom Brevoort wrote a column on the Fly being a precursor to the creation of Spider-Man. The Fly's companion was Fly Girl debuted in 1961 created by Robert Bernstein and John Rosenberger. Fly Girl was published in DC comics and is part of the New Crusaders published by Archie Comics. At an early age back in the early 60's when I first discovered Super-Hero comics, I eagerly sought any that I could find. Some of those that I found were the Super-Hero line from Archie Comics. I was most taken by The Fly and Fly Girl. The John Rosenberger art was as good as anything else being published at the time and Fly Girl was my favorite Super-Heroine at the time. Nostalgically, I always wanted to add a John Rosenberger piece with Fly Girl to my collection and this checks all the boxes. Plus a Giant Gorilla! Social/Sharing |
